Abstract :
Planar waveguide arrays are promising candidates for high gain, high efficiency antennas in millimeter-wave systems. Authors are driving forward a 5 year project on "RF coexisting technology on high speed baseband IC for millimeter wave radio systems" which is supported by Ministry of Internal Affairs and Communications (MIC) funding as well as Industry\´ s participation. This paper introduces the project and the planar waveguide antennas which characterize it. Among various activities in the project, bandwidth enhancement of the series fed hollow waveguide arrays as well as the loss estimation of the post-wall waveguide antennas are discussed in detail.
